The Two Devils

The Two Devils

The Levels of Self-Criticism Scale, (Thompson and Zuroff), measures the two types of self-criticism: comparative and internalized.

Comparative self-criticism involves comparing to others & finding one’s self to be lacking. Self-critical people in this way often tend to base their self-esteem on perceptions of the way others feel about them and may view other individuals as superior, critical, and/or hostile.

Internalized self-criticism, may involve the feeling one cannot possibly live up to personal ideals or standards or the belief that one is deficient in some way. Even success is failure.
